Topic: Should governments invest in cultural infrastructure?


Model Answer:

In today's world, where technological advancements are rapidly changing the way we live and work, it is crucial for governments to consider investing in cultural infrastructure. This investment could not only preserve the nation's heritage but also contribute to the overall development of a country by promoting tourism, education, and social cohesion.

On one hand, preserving a nation’s cultural heritage requires significant financial investment. Governments need to allocate resources for the restoration and maintenance of historical monuments, museums, libraries, and other cultural institutions. This is essential as these sites are not only symbols of national identity but also attract tourists from around the world, contributing to the country's economy. For instance, in 2019, France’s tourism industry generated over €46 billion due to its rich historical and artistic heritage.

Furthermore, investing in cultural infrastructure supports education by encouraging a greater appreciation for arts and culture. By providing adequate funding for art programs, schools can enhance students' creativity and critical thinking skills. For example, the National Endowment for the Arts (NEA) in the United States has shown that arts education improves student performance in both academic and non-academic areas.

Additionally, investing in cultural infrastructure promotes social cohesion by bringing people from diverse backgrounds together to celebrate their shared culture and values. Public art installations, performances, and festivals create a sense of belonging and unity within the community. In Canada, the Cultural Spaces Fund has helped create vibrant public spaces that encourage interaction among residents and promote social inclusion.

In conclusion, investing in cultural infrastructure is a crucial endeavour for governments worldwide. By preserving national heritage, promoting education through arts programs, and fostering social cohesion, such investment contributes significantly to the overall development of a country. As a result, governments should prioritize allocating resources to ensure the continued growth and prosperity of cultural infrastructure.
